Ein wundervollen schönen guten Tag, bitte seid gnädig mit mir. Ich hab von meinem Professor eine Aufgabe bekommen und soll einem Gerät via CAN Bus eine Nachrichten schicken das dieser einen Wert ändern soll. Ich soll dafür eine Skriptsprache verwendet wie Python. Ich hab mich in die Doku des entsprechenden Gerätes gelesen und verstehe wie ich diesen Wert senden soll aber was ich nicht verstehe ist die grundsätzliche Programmierung. Ich hab im Internet jetzt "einige" Minuten recherchiert und bekomme es einfach nicht hin, egal in welcher Programmiersprache, mich mit diesem Gerät zu verbinden bzw es anzusprechen. Hätte jemand ein schönes Tutorial wie man ein Gerät über den Rechner via (USB to-) CAN erreichen kann, oder ein paar zeilen Code wie ich die Schnittstelle anspreche ? Ich wäre euch auch für Anmerkungen oder Ideen sehr dankbar Gruß Ado
Suche nach pcan Python. Pcan ist ein usb-can Adapter von Peak.
Ado schrieb: > Hätte jemand ein schönes Tutorial wie man ein Gerät über > den Rechner via (USB to-) CAN erreichen kann, oder ein paar zeilen Code > wie ich die Schnittstelle anspreche ? Das hängt ganz vom CAN-Bus Adapter ab den du verwendest. Jeder CAN-Adapter hat vom Hersteller eigentlich einen Beispielcode dabei.
Ich verwende für sowas den USBtin (https://www.fischl.de/usbtin/). Da gibt es auch eine Python-Lib. Ein konkretes Python-Beispiel: https://github.com/fishpepper/pyUSBtin/blob/master/examples/vw_t5_ignition_on.py
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.